CTC boosts Govt Revenue in 2008

The Government recorded an increase of Rs 3.9 billion in revenue from the legal cigarette manufacturers, for the first six months ended June 30, 2008, mainly attributed to the excise led price increases and declining volumes of illegal and counterfeit products in the local market.

Ceylon Tobacco Company (CTC) stated that Government Revenue from the tobacco industry has grown from Rs.19.3 Billion during the six months ended June 30, 2007 to Rs. 23.2 billion during the same period in 2008.

However, industry volumes continue to decline, largely driven by the reduction in the number of consumers and their average daily consumption levels. During the period under review CTC's total sales volume declined over the same period last year.
